Transforming your space into a charming abode requires a blend of creativity and strategic planning. One of the first decor secrets to consider is the power of color. Opting for a cohesive color palette can unify the different elements of your room, making it feel more harmonious. Use light, airy hues for a fresh vibe, or deep, rich tones for a cozy ambiance. Additionally, consider adding accent walls to create visual interest and highlight specific areas of your space. This simple change can dramatically alter how your room feels and functions.
Another essential tip is to incorporate texture through various materials. Mixing fabrics like velvet, linen, and cotton can add depth to your decor. Don't shy away from using natural elements such as wood and stone, which can introduce an organic feel to your home. To elevate your space even further, think about adding personal touches, such as framed photos or artwork that resonates with you. This not only enhances visual appeal but also adds a layer of warmth and personality to your home.

The psychology of color plays a crucial role in shaping our emotions and perceptions, making it essential to choose the right palette for your home. Different colors evoke different feelings; for instance, blue is often associated with tranquility and calmness, while yellow can inspire feelings of happiness and energy. When selecting a color scheme, consider how certain hues make you feel and how they correspond with the atmosphere you wish to create in each room. Additionally, think about the natural light the space receives, as it can significantly alter how colors appear at different times of the day.
To effectively incorporate color into your home design, start by identifying a color palette that resonates with your personal style and lifestyle. A useful technique is to choose three main colors: a dominant color for the walls, a secondary color for larger furniture pieces, and an accent color for decor items like cushions or artwork. This balanced approach ensures cohesiveness throughout your space while allowing for creativity and experimentation. Remember to test samples in your home to see how they interact with each other and the existing elements in your rooms.
When it comes to interior design, understanding your personal style is crucial in overcoming various decor dilemmas. Whether you lean towards the modern minimalism of Scandinavian design or are drawn to the warm, rustic charm of farmhouse aesthetics, identifying your unique tastes is the first step in creating a cohesive living space. Start by evaluating your current decor pieces. Consider what you love and what you could do without. This process can include asking yourself questions such as, 'What colors make me feel happy?' or 'Which materials resonate with my personality?'.
Once you have a clearer picture of your style, the next step is to express it through your decor choices. Utilize elements like color, texture, and furniture arrangement to reflect your personality in your space. For instance, if you favor a bohemian vibe, incorporate layered textiles, plants, and vintage finds. Alternatively, if a sleek, contemporary feel speaks to you, opt for clean lines and a monochromatic palette. Remember, there are no strict rules—mix and match styles that resonate with you, creating harmonious spaces that tell your story.
